Output 43e18651023a8c20384f06bae947301e5dd9809cc040bdc90fb388a9e9d8966e:0

value
4582860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c62cb4593cadd3d1ffb9b1bdefc76f60ec9a8e34 OP_EQUALVERIFY OP_CHECKSIG
address
1K4rM74uZJ42LCAkfRsucym2Ptf7L6jtAJ
transaction
43e18651023a8c20384f06bae947301e5dd9809cc040bdc90fb388a9e9d8966e
spent
true